Подскажите пожалуйста почему скрипт хорошо работая в 5-ой, отказывается работать в 8-ой, т.к. и в 7-ой.
Это один из уроков взятых с Flasher.ru (пузырики)
Ситуация такая 3 фрейма, в каждом из них скрипт
первый фрейм:

Код:
maxobject = "50";
counter = 1;
while (Number(counter)<Number(maxobject)) {
duplicateMovieClip("/round", "round" add counter, counter);
setProperty("round" add counter, _x, random(11)+40);
setProperty("round" add counter, _y, random(600));
scale = Number(random(40))+20;
setProperty("round" add counter, _xscale, scale);
setProperty("round" add counter, _yscale, scale);
counter = Number(counter)+1;
}
второй фрейм:

Код:
counter = 1;
while (Number(counter)<Number(maxobject)) {
setProperty("round" add counter, _x, getProperty("round" add counter, _x)+Random (7)-3);
setProperty("round" add counter, _y, getProperty("round" add counter, _y)-(getProperty("round" add counter, _xscale)-20)/10-1);
if (getProperty("round" add counter, _y)<0) {
setProperty("round" add counter, _x, random(11)+40);
setProperty("round" add counter, _y, 600);
scale = Number(random(40))+20;
setProperty("round" add counter, _xscale, scale);
setProperty("round" add counter, _yscale, scale);
}
counter = Number(counter)+1;
}
третий фрейм:

Код:
gotoAndPlay(_currentframe-1);
Подскажите что поправить, и объясните пожалуйста почему неработает